Irish Land League Agitation Mug
English School's Irish Land League Agitation, illustrations from 'The Illustrated London News', October 29th 1881 located at a Private Collection. The Irish Land League Agitation, illustrations from 'The Illustrated London News', October 29th 1881 was created around 1881 AD.
$15.50